People are unsure as to which home theater is suitable for their family. A large home theater doesn't necessarily means that it's perfect for one's family. So how does one make out as to which is the perfect one for them? Several companies offer various types of designs suggestion but ultimately it's for you to decide. Only you can decide as to what is the best for you.
Customize your own home theater
You need to buy a home theater which suits your room perfectly. The choice of home theater depends on various things like the size of the room, its color, the furniture and many others. You should purchase the products carefully. Do not go for big equipments if your room is not big enough. You also have to keep in mind the lighting of the room before you decide on the final product. Though companies offer design advice, yet the best option is to do it yourself. That is because no one can understand your requirements the way you will.
While buying a home theater, you need to decide on either of these two; a better sound or a larger picture. Both these things are essential but at the same time very costly. So you need to know your preferences. If you have a big budget, then of course you can go for both of them. However on a restricted budget, you may have to compromise on the size. You can of course get good quality picture as well as sound on a restricted budget too. So be careful and invest wisely. Get the best option available within your budget.
The next important thing is seating arrangement. You need to have a seating arrangement which will go with your home theater. You should never compromise on comfort. That should ideally be your first priority. From loungers to couches, you have many options. Simple seats will cost you less however one needs to remember that it's ultimately all about comfort so don't compromise on it even if it means spending a bit more. You will probably sit on the couches for hours, so don't mind spending more on them.
Have a big budget? Go for interior decorators
You can also get the interior decorators to customize your home theater. However the biggest problem here is the cost. These interior decorators charge a large amount. So you need to have huge budget if you want to avail their services. Designing the home theater on your own still remains the best option. You can do it in your style. You can take suggestions from friends and family members. You can find various tips on customizing your home theater in magazines. Home Theater For Dummies
A home theater needs to be functional before it's anything
else. Those who have put in the expense to build a "theater"
in their home need to be sure the sound and visual and
placement of seating is just right before they'll delve
into decorating, but when that time comes, there are some
tips to add to the room aesthetically without taking away
any of the functionality.
A room of this sort is bound to have floor speakers, and
speakers that surround your peripherals and centrally located
speakers for both the front and back of the sitting area. In
some of the newer homes or the more expensive remodels, some,
if not all, of these speakers may be placed in the walls of
the home. Yet usually the floor speakers will remain out and
near the television. The tops of which may be a prime
opportunity for knickknacks when decorating. There may be
shelving on the walls in this room for speakers or for
remote controls. Those shelves are also a great place for
decorative touches.
A typical theater room is designed something like this: The
television is centrally located either mounted on the wall
or standing just in front of it. There are floor speakers
on either side of the television and another smaller speaker
centrally located above the TV. There will be more speakers
either mounted or on stands placed on either side of the
seating area and one more speaker centrally located behind
the seating area. Finally, there will be a special speaker
called a subwoofer placed somewhere to the side of the
seating area. The seating area is located around what some
refer to as the "sweet spot" because during the action
scenes in intense movies when the music swells, the
vibrations of that sound are felt in the seating area. All
of this is necessary for the functionality of the theater
room. What's left is what you have to decorate.
In order to keep the functionality of a theater room, you
must realize that the room needs to be dark. This is no
room for growing plants or bright colors painted on the
wall. Rich earthy tones will work here. Along with this,
keep knickknacks to a minimum. This room is for viewing
the television, not your china collection. Do not place
fragile things in this room. There will be much vibration
in this room and that may cause a fragile item to fall
from its perch and break. Keep your decor simple here.
Use rugs to add color to the room and hang pictures to
add depth to the walls. Do not clutter up this room with
much more than this.
